Why Water & Flood Damage Happens in Mill River, Massachusetts
Mill River faces water and flood damage from a variety of local causes including storms, heavy rain, and snowmelt. Plumbing leaks, appliance overflows, and seepage through foundation cracks also contribute to damage in both residential and commercial properties.
Water damage restoration in Mill River
- Storms and heavy rain can cause water intrusion through roofs, windows, and foundations.
- Snowmelt and poor grading may lead to basement seepage and standing water.
- Leaks from plumbing and appliances often go unnoticed until damage occurs.
- Fire and smoke events can add complexity to water damage restoration efforts.
Why Fast Action Matters
Prompt restoration helps limit secondary damage like mold growth and lingering odors while improving drying outcomes and protecting building materials.

Request rebuild helpOur 7-Step Water, Flood, Storm & Fire Damage Restoration Process
In Mill River, Massachusetts, we approach each restoration project with a thorough inspection and moisture assessment to ensure a complete recovery. Our 7 Step Water Flood Storm & Fire Damage Restoration Process is designed to address damage safely and effectively.
-
Step 1: Initial Call and Safety Guidance
We begin with a careful intake call to understand the situation and provide safety-first advice, emphasizing professional evaluation before any actions to protect occupants and property. -
Step 2: Detailed Inspection and Moisture Mapping
Our experts conduct a comprehensive inspection to identify water or fire damage sources such as plumbing leaks, storm flooding, roof leaks, or seepage, using moisture meters and thermal imaging to map affected areas. -
Step 3: Water Extraction and Pump-Out
We promptly remove standing water using professional-grade extraction equipment, minimizing further damage and preparing the structure for drying. -
Step 4: Structural Drying Planning
Based on moisture mapping, we develop a drying plan utilizing air movers and dehumidifiers strategically placed to restore optimal drying conditions. -
Step 5: Containment and HEPA Air Filtration
When necessary, containment barriers and HEPA filtration systems are deployed to control airborne contaminants and prevent cross-contamination during restoration. -
Step 6: Cleaning, Sanitizing, and Odor Control
All affected areas and contents are cleaned and sanitized using EPA-registered products, with targeted deodorization to address lingering odors from water, smoke, or mold. -
Step 7: Contents Handling and Repair Planning
We carefully pack out and salvage contents when possible, then coordinate with you on repair and reconstruction plans to restore your property after drying is complete.

What should I do first if I discover water damage in my Mill River home?
Your safety is the priority. First, turn off the electricity in the affected area and avoid wading through standing water. Contact our team for a professional assessment and swift water extraction.
How do you detect the source of leaks or moisture in my property?
We utilize advanced leak detection technology to identify the source of moisture. This allows us to address the root cause effectively and prevent future issues in your Mill River residence or business.
What does the water extraction and drying process involve?
Our team will perform water extraction using powerful pumps, followed by a tailored drying plan that includes air movers to circulate air and reduce humidity levels effectively in your Mill River property.
When is HEPA filtration necessary during the restoration process?
HEPA filtration is crucial when dealing with contaminated water or mold. We implement containment strategies and HEPA air filtration to ensure that your indoor air quality is safe during the cleanup and sanitization stages.
